Marking Tasks as Out of Scope

Sometimes a specific task or policy of a compliance standard will not be relevant to your business. While this can be for a variety of reasons, it's important to know how to marks tasks as non-applicable to your scope.

First, click Review on your desired task within the Outstanding Tasks area. See below:

From here, scroll down to the bottom of the task. Now select Out of scope.

Doing this will remove that specific task from your Outstanding Tasks queue and prevent OneClickComply from identifying it as a gap during any subsequent scans. In a future update, tasks marked as Out of scope will be moved into a separate area to be reviewed by users at a later date.

Note: Please ensure that tasks are not accidentally marked as Out of scope, otherwise compliance standing indications within the platform, such as the report card area, will not give an accurate representation of your compliance with a standard's technical controls.
